当前位置 主页 > 技术大全 >

    VPMC模块启动失败:VMware问题解析
    VMWARE模块化VPMC启动失败

    栏目:技术大全 时间:2025-03-07 19:12



    解析VMware模块化VPMC启动失败:深入根源与解决方案 在虚拟化技术日新月异的今天,VMware凭借其强大的功能和灵活性,成为了众多企业和数据中心的首选平台

        然而,即便是在如此成熟和稳定的系统中,偶尔也会出现一些令人头疼的问题,其中“VMware模块化VPMC(vSphere Platform Management Controller)启动失败”便是较为典型的一个

        本文将深入探讨VPMC启动失败的原因、可能的影响以及一系列详尽的解决方案,旨在帮助管理员迅速定位并解决问题,确保虚拟化环境的稳定运行

         一、VPMC简介及其重要性 VPMC,全称为vSphere Platform Management Controller,是VMware vSphere 7.0及以后版本中引入的一个关键组件

        它负责管理和监控ESXi主机的硬件健康状况,包括电源管理、风扇控制、温度监控等,是保障物理服务器稳定运行的重要一环

        VPMC通过模块化设计,实现了与vSphere核心功能的解耦,提高了系统的可维护性和可扩展性

         VPMC的正常运行对于维护虚拟化环境的整体健康至关重要

        一旦VPMC启动失败,不仅会导致硬件监控功能失效,还可能影响ESXi主机的自动恢复和电源管理策略,严重时甚至威胁到服务器的物理安全和数据完整性

         二、VPMC启动失败的原因分析 VPMC启动失败可能由多种因素引起,以下是一些常见的原因: 1.固件或BIOS版本不兼容:某些服务器厂商发布的固件或BIOS版本可能与VPMC存在不兼容问题,导致VPMC模块无法正常加载

         2.配置错误:在配置VPMC时,如果设置不当,如错误的IP地址、错误的认证信息等,可能导致VPMC服务启动失败

         3.硬件故障:服务器的硬件问题,如BMC(Baseboard Management Controller)故障、网络接口卡故障等,也可能间接影响到VPMC的启动

         4.软件缺陷或补丁冲突:VMware发布的某些补丁或更新可能与VPMC存在冲突,导致服务异常

         5.资源限制:如CPU、内存资源紧张,也可能影响VPMC模块的初始化过程

         6.网络问题:VPMC依赖于网络通信,网络配置错误或网络不稳定可能导致VPMC无法正确注册或通信

         三、VPMC启动失败的影响 VPMC启动失败将对虚拟化环境产生一系列负面影响: - 硬件监控缺失:服务器硬件的健康状态无法被实时监控,可能导致硬件故障未能及时发现,增加数据丢失和服务中断的风险

         - 电源管理失效:服务器的自动电源管理策略无法执行,影响能耗效率和服务器的远程管理能力

         - 运维效率下降:管理员依赖于VPMC提供的信息进行故障排查和维护,VPMC失效将增加运维难度和时间成本

         - 安全风险增加:硬件级别的安全监控缺失,可能使服务器更容易受到物理攻击

         四、解决方案与步骤 针对VPMC启动失败的问题,以下是一套系统性的排查和解决步骤: 1.检查固件和BIOS版本: - 确认服务器固件和BIOS是否为最新版本,必要时从服务器厂商官网下载并更新

         - 检查固件/BIOS更新日志,确认是否有关于VPMC的兼容性说明

         2.审核VPMC配置: - 登录vSphere Client,检查VPMC的配置设置,包括IP地址、网关、DNS服务器等

         - 确保VPMC使用的账户具有足够的权限,且认证信息正确无误

         3.硬件诊断: - 运行服务器的内置硬件诊断工具,检查BMC、NIC等关键硬件的健康状态

         - 如果可能,尝试更换疑似故障的硬件部件

         4.软件补丁管理: - 检查并应用VMware推荐的补丁和更新,确保VPMC模块与vSphere版本兼容

         - 如果问题出现在特定补丁安装后,考虑回滚该补丁并联系VMware支持获取帮助

         5.资源监控与调整: - 使用vSphere监控工具检查ESXi主机的资源使用情况,确保有足够的CPU和内存资源供VPMC使用

         - 优化资源分配,避免资源争用导致的服务启动失败

         6.网络配置检查: - 确认VPMC所在网络配置正确,包括VLAN、子网掩码、路由设置等

         - 使用ping、traceroute等命令测试网络连接,确保VPMC能正常访问必要的网络资源

         7.查看日志与联系支持: - 查看VPMC和ESXi主机的日志文件,寻找启动失败的具体错误信息

         - 如果问题依旧无法解决,联系VMware官方支持团队,提供详细的错误日志和系统配置信息

         五、总结 VMware模块化VPMC启动失败是一个复杂且影响广泛的问题,涉及硬件、软件、配置等多个层面

        通过系统的排查步骤,结合固件更新、配置审核、硬件诊断、软件补丁管理、资源调整和网络配置检查,大多数VPMC启动失败的问题都能得到有效解决

        重要的是,管理员应保持对虚拟化环境的持续监控,及时响应和处理任何潜在的异常,以确保系统的稳定运行和数据安全

        同时,积极与VMware社区和官方支持团队合作,利用社区的智慧和官方的专业支持,不断提升自身的运维能力和问题解决效率